15-hour water cut in Mahara and Gampaha areas on Wednesday

The National Water Supply and Drainage Board has announced a 15-hour water supply cut for residents of Mahara and Gampaha.

The water cut has been attributed to essential maintenance work to be carried out on pipelines related to the construction activities on the Central Expressway.

Accordingly, the water supply will be suspended from 4:00 p.m. on Wednesday (17) to 7:00 a.m. on Thursday (18).
